  • I was getting concerned bc I haven't felt this one nearly as much as I did with DD. When I went for my u/s the other day he told me my placenta is anterior, which means it's on the front of my belly.  Apparently that makes a huge difference in feeling movement bc of the extra cushion.

    Your baby could also be facing backward right now and if kicking that way you may not feel as much as if he were outward facing.
